How much does it cost to rent a home in Fort Myers Outlying?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Fort Myers Outlying 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,179 | $725 | $10,000+ |
Fort Myers Outlying 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,748 | $1,395 | $10,000+ |
Fort Myers Outlying 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,931 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
Fort Myers Outlying 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,054 | $2,500 | $10,000+ |
Fort Myers Outlying 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,525 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
Fort Myers Outlying 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,200 | $3,200 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fort Myers Outlying
What type of rentals are currently available in Fort Myers Outlying?
There are currently 923 Apartments for Rent in Fort Myers Outlying, FL with pricing that ranges from $735 to $11,530. There are also 3636 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Fort Myers Outlying ranging from $725 to $100,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Fort Myers Outlying?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Fort Myers Outlying ranges from $725 to $100,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,902.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Fort Myers Outlying?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Fort Myers Outlying range from $1,396 to $11,530,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,395 to $55,530.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$735.
